国产精品1024永久观看,大尺度欧美暖暖视频在线观看,亚洲宅男精品一区在线观看,欧美日韩一区二区三区视频,2021中文字幕在线观看

  • <option id="fbvk0"></option>
    1. <rt id="fbvk0"><tr id="fbvk0"></tr></rt>
      <center id="fbvk0"><optgroup id="fbvk0"></optgroup></center>
      <center id="fbvk0"></center>

      <li id="fbvk0"><abbr id="fbvk0"><dl id="fbvk0"></dl></abbr></li>

      Windows激活自動測試方法

      文檔序號:8487671閱讀:627來源:國知局
      Windows激活自動測試方法
      【專利說明】
      【技術(shù)領(lǐng)域】
      [0001]本發(fā)明涉及一種自動測試方法,具體涉及一種windows激活自動測試方法。
      【【背景技術(shù)】】
      [0002]激活技術(shù)一直是Windows的重要組成部分,微軟向生產(chǎn)商提供了 OA (OEMActivat1n)激活技術(shù),利用OA激活技術(shù),原始設(shè)備制造商可以通過主板批量激活特定Windows系統(tǒng)副本。例如現(xiàn)有的Window7/Vista搭載的分別為0A2.1和0A2.0的激活技術(shù)。
      [0003]隨著科技的發(fā)展,Window8將OA技術(shù)已升級到0A3.0,通過加入聯(lián)機驗證的機制,用以防止傳統(tǒng)的通過模擬B1S的信息繞過激活的情形,所述0A3.0的激活流程為:(1)請求階段:由0EM/0DM廠商(可以是工廠也可以是公司)向Microsoft提出購買DPK (DigitalProduct Key)的需求,付賬后0EM/0DM廠商通過WEB或?qū)S星婪绞饺ツ萌PK ;(2)flash階段:工廠端將拿到的DPK利用0A3.0tool生成DPK的序列號,并插入到機臺的B1S中,同時根據(jù)機臺的配置再通過0A3.0工具生成一硬件哈希值(hashcode),所述序列號及所述哈希值會生成CBR (computer Build Report) ; (3) report階段:將所述CBR發(fā)送給微軟,由微軟根據(jù)收到的序列號及哈希值進行判斷后并給予0EM/0DM廠商反饋。在工廠端,上述激活流程的各階段均是單項操作的,需要人工手動執(zhí)行各階段的激活,同時由各階段單獨判斷測試結(jié)果,最后由人工根據(jù)各階段的測試結(jié)果從而來判定激活的過程是否成功,然而人為操作可能會導致某個階段的漏測,且人為查看,易導致誤判,漏看等現(xiàn)象,且激活后的結(jié)果也無法保存,后續(xù)也無法追蹤。
      [0004]有鑒于此,實有必要提供一種Windows激活自動測試方法,以解決上述激活流程的各階段無法自動連接跳轉(zhuǎn)執(zhí)行下一階段的問題,同時解決人為操作在各階段漏測或漏看,及激活的結(jié)果無法保存和追蹤的問題。

      【發(fā)明內(nèi)容】

      [0005]因此,本發(fā)明的目的是提供一種Windows激活自動測試方法,以解決上述問題。
      [0006]為了達到上述目的,本發(fā)明提供的Windows激活自動測試方法,其應(yīng)用于Windows8的激活技術(shù)中,所述Windows8的激活的流程依次包括三個階段:請求階段、flash階段及report階段,所述方法包括以下步驟:
      [0007](I)在所述請求階段后生成請求標記檔;
      [0008](2)當程序檢測到所述請求記檔后,自動跳轉(zhuǎn)到所述flash階段,在所述flash階段完成后將所述請求標記檔刪除,并生成刷新標記檔;
      [0009](3)當所述程序檢測到所述刷新標記檔后,自動跳轉(zhuǎn)到所述import階段,在所述report階段完成后將所述刷新標記檔刪除,并生成LOG檔;
      [0010](4)由所述程序判斷所述LOG檔的內(nèi)容,若所述LOG檔記錄為“0”,則執(zhí)行步驟
      (5),若所述LOG檔記錄為“ I”,則執(zhí)行步驟(7);
      [0011](5)測試成功,所述WindowsS激活,則記錄結(jié)果并上傳至服務(wù)器;
      [0012](6)重新啟動操作系統(tǒng),并將所述LOG檔上傳到SFCS (shop floor controlsystem,車間控制系統(tǒng)),從而由所述SFCS處理后自動過站;
      [0013](7)測試失敗,所述WindowsS未激活,則記錄結(jié)果并上傳至服務(wù)器。
      [0014]較佳的,所述LOG檔還記錄有所述flash階段后生成的DPK序列號的信息、硬件哈希值的信息及產(chǎn)品SN (Serial Number,產(chǎn)品流水號)的信息。
      [0015]較佳的,所述請求標記檔以“reqflag.txt”命名。
      [0016]較佳的,所述刷新標記檔以“flashflag.txt”命名。
      [0017]相較于現(xiàn)有技術(shù),本發(fā)明Windows激活自動測試方法實現(xiàn)了 Windows8激活流程中各階段的自動連接,克服了激活流程中各階段需手動執(zhí)行的缺陷,避免了人為單項操作產(chǎn)生的漏測及漏看的問題,且本發(fā)明還能夠保存WindowsS是否被激活的結(jié)果,從而保證了產(chǎn)品的質(zhì)量,通過上傳服務(wù)器和SFCS保證了后續(xù)的追蹤。
      【【附圖說明】】
      [0018]圖1繪示為本發(fā)明Windows激活自動測試方法的流程圖。
      【【具體實施方式】】
      [0019]為了達到上述目的,請參閱圖1繪示,本發(fā)明提供的Windows激活自動測試方法,其應(yīng)用于Windows8的0A3.0的激活技術(shù)中,所述Windows8的激活的流程依次包括三個階段:請求階段、flash階段及import階段,所述方法包括以下步驟:
      [0020]SlOl:在所述請求階段后生成請求標記檔;
      [0021]S102:當程序檢測到所述請求記檔后,自動跳轉(zhuǎn)到所述flash階段,在所述flash階段完成后將所述請求標記檔刪除,并生成刷新標記檔;
      [0022]S103:當所述程序檢測到所述刷新標記檔后,自動跳轉(zhuǎn)到所述import階段,在所述report階段完成后將所述刷新標記檔刪除,并生成LOG檔;
      [0023]S104:由所述程序判斷所述LOG檔的內(nèi)容,若所述LOG檔記錄為“0”,則執(zhí)行步驟S105,若所述LOG檔記錄為“ I ”,則執(zhí)行步驟S107 ;
      [0024]S105:測試成功,所述Windows8激活,則記錄結(jié)果并上傳至服務(wù)器;
      [0025]S106:重新啟動操作系統(tǒng),并將所述LOG檔上傳到SFCS (shop floor controlsystem,車間控制系統(tǒng)),從而由所述SFCS處理后自動過站;
      [0026]S107:測試失敗,所述Windows8未激活,則記錄結(jié)果并上傳至服務(wù)器。
      [0027]其中,所述LOG檔還記錄有所述flash階段后生成的DPK序列號的信息、硬件哈希值的信息及產(chǎn)品SN (Serial Number,產(chǎn)品流水號)的信息。
      [0028]其中,所述請求標記檔以“reqflag.txt”命名。
      [0029]其中,所述刷新標記檔以“flashflag.txt”命名。
      [0030]于測試時,由工作人員通過條碼槍將流程卡上產(chǎn)品SN的信息及DPK料號的信息掃入機臺,此時由程序開始執(zhí)行激活流程中的請求階段,于本實施例中,為了不浪費每個DPK,因此在請求到DPK之后,在flash階段之前,程序會先判斷機臺是否存在刷新標記檔,若存在此時會將所述請求到的DPK刪除,若不存在,則根據(jù)本發(fā)明的測試方法依次執(zhí)行flash階段和report階段。
      [0031]本發(fā)明Windows激活自動測試方法實現(xiàn)了 Windows8激活流程中各階段的自動連接,克服了激活流程中各階段需手動執(zhí)行的缺陷,避免了人為單項操作產(chǎn)生的漏測及漏看的問題,且本發(fā)明還能夠保存WindowsS是否被激活的結(jié)果,從而保證了產(chǎn)品的質(zhì)量,通過上傳服務(wù)器和SFCS保證了后續(xù)的追蹤。
      【主權(quán)項】
      1.一種Windows激活自動測試方法,其應(yīng)用于Windows8的激活技術(shù)中,所述Windows8的激活的流程依次包括三個階段:請求階段、flash階段及import階段,其特征在于,所述方法包括以下步驟: (1)在所述請求階段后生成請求標記檔; (2)當程序檢測到所述請求記檔后,自動跳轉(zhuǎn)到所述flash階段,在所述flash階段完成后將所述請求標記檔刪除,并生成刷新標記檔; (3)當所述程序檢測到所述刷新標記檔后,自動跳轉(zhuǎn)到所述report階段,在所述report階段完成后將所述刷新標記檔刪除,并生成LOG檔; (4)由所述程序判斷所述LOG檔的內(nèi)容,若所述LOG檔記錄為“0”,則執(zhí)行步驟(5),若所述LOG檔記錄為“1”,則執(zhí)行步驟(7); (5)測試成功,所述WindowsS激活,則記錄結(jié)果并上傳至服務(wù)器; (6)重新啟動操作系統(tǒng),并將所述LOG檔上傳到SFCS,從而由所述SFCS處理后自動過站; (7)測試失敗,所述WindowsS未激活,則記錄結(jié)果并上傳至服務(wù)器。
      2.根據(jù)權(quán)利要求1所述的Windows激活自動測試方法,其特征在于,所述LOG檔還記錄有所述flash階段后生成的DPK序列號的信息、硬件哈希值的信息及產(chǎn)品SN的信息。
      3.根據(jù)權(quán)利要求1所述的Windows激活自動測試方法,其特征在于,所述請求標記檔以“reqflag.txt” 命名。
      4.根據(jù)權(quán)利要求1所述的Windows激活自動測試方法,其特征在于,所述刷新標記檔以^flashflag.txt”命名。
      【專利摘要】一種Windows激活自動測試方法,其包括步驟:(1)在該請求階段后生成請求標記檔;(2)當程序檢測到該請求記檔后,自動跳轉(zhuǎn)到該flash階段,在該flash階段完成后將該請求標記檔刪除,并生成刷新標記檔;(3)當該程序檢測到該刷新標記檔后,自動跳轉(zhuǎn)到該report階段,在該report階段完成后將該刷新標記檔刪除,并生成LOG檔;(4)由該程序判斷該LOG檔的內(nèi)容,若該LOG檔記錄為“0”,則執(zhí)行步驟(5),若該LOG檔記錄為“1”,則執(zhí)行步驟(7);(5)測試成功,該Windows8激活,則記錄結(jié)果并上傳至服務(wù)器;(6)重新啟動操作系統(tǒng),并將該LOG檔上傳到SFCS;(7)測試失敗,該Windows8未激活,則記錄結(jié)果并上傳至服務(wù)器。本發(fā)明避免了人為操作的缺陷,保證了后續(xù)結(jié)果的保存和追蹤。
      【IPC分類】G06F9-445
      【公開號】CN104809004
      【申請?zhí)枴緾N201410033934
      【發(fā)明人】王麗云
      【申請人】神訊電腦(昆山)有限公司
      【公開日】2015年7月29日
      【申請日】2014年1月24日
      網(wǎng)友詢問留言 已有0條留言
      • 還沒有人留言評論。精彩留言會獲得點贊!
      1